Tenuta San Guido’s 2012 Sassicaia is a legendary Super Tuscan wine, crafted primarily from Cabernet Sauvignon with a small percentage of Cabernet Franc. The 2012 vintage benefitted from a temperate growing season, with a warm, dry summer balanced by cool nights conducive to slow, even ripening. The estate, nestling in Bolgheri near the Tyrrhenian coast, is renowned for its singular terroir. Gravelly soils evoke the Médoc and offer perfect drainage for the predominantly Bordeaux varietals. Sassicaia’s careful vinification includes fermentation in stainless steel, followed by ageing in French oak barriques, imbuing the wine with both finesse and impressive longevity.
Tuscany, with its rolling hills and Mediterranean climate, boasts a rich viticultural heritage. The proximity to the sea moderates temperatures, ensuring ample warmth while preserving fresh acidity in the grapes. The coastal strip of Bolgheri is relatively young in terms of fine wine history, yet it has made its mark globally thanks to visionary winemaking and an embrace of international varieties. Historic estates such as Tenuta San Guido infuse modern techniques with respect for the land, resulting in wines that express both place and pedigree.
Sassicaia 2012 offers enticing aromas of blackcurrant, tobacco, cedar and graphite, underscored by a finely-knit structure and velvety tannins. This wine is a superb partner for red meats such as Chianina beef, whether grilled tagliata or a classic bistecca alla Fiorentina. Its complexity and poise also complement game, wild boar ragù or aged cheeses like Pecorino Toscano. Truffle dishes, such as hand-cut pappardelle with black truffle, will also harmonise beautifully, highlighting the wine’s subtle savoury nuances.
For optimal enjoyment, decant the Sassicaia 2012 for an hour to allow full expression of its bouquet. Serve at 16-18°C, and savour its elegance alongside well-chosen, flavourful dishes that reflect the best of Tuscan gastronomy.
